Driving licences used to be built on the European format, as defined by Directive 91/439/EEC. They consisted of a tri-fold pink paper document that contained a photo of the driver, their personal information and home address. The front of the licence included an alphabetical list in code format of the categories of trailers and vehicles for which the driver held a licence.
In the EU the format was replaced with an updated version that has personal information and a photo on both sides of a plastic card in blue. It also features a colour-coded system that indicates the vehicle's category or. A vehicle that falls under category B1 will be marked with code 152.
